Panel Permits

Martinez follows California's streamlined solar permitting requirements under AB 2188 and SB 379, issuing over-the-counter or online permits for standard residential rooftop PV systems typically within one business day. Title 24 Part 6 requires solar on most new homes. California Civil Code Section 714 prohibits HOA and local restrictions that significantly reduce system performance.

California Civil Code § 714

714. (a) Any covenant, restriction, or condition contained in any deed, contract, security instrument, or other instrument affecting the transfer or sale of, or any interest in, real property, and any provision of a governing document, as defined in Section 4150 or 6552, that effectively prohibits or restricts the installation or use of a solar energy system is void and unenforceable.
